Output 8012640a448652653e3bf1caf081d88b7621c84aab7d5eb68c1acdf7efd23a84:78

value
386928
script pubkey
OP_0 OP_PUSHBYTES_32 79c043d3a8ac8b62ea770611ca792e0d1cc595e8d98f626d1d4dbce0aa6683b1
address
bc1q08qy85ag4j9k96nhqcgu57fwp5wvt90gmx8kymgafk7wp2nxswcsznasu6
transaction
8012640a448652653e3bf1caf081d88b7621c84aab7d5eb68c1acdf7efd23a84
spent
true